文档章节

linux 安装mysql步骤

m
 miketom155
发布于 2017/06/03 15:01
字数 404
阅读 17
收藏 0

1.下载安装包

wget http://cdn.mysql.com/archives/mysql-5.6/mysql-5.6.26-linux-glibc2.5-x86_64.tar.gz 

 

2.解压安装包

tar zxvf http://cdn.mysql.com/archives/mysql-5.6/mysql-5.6.26-linux-glibc2.5-x86_64.tar.gz 

 

3.进入文件夹

cd mysql-5.6.26-linux-glibc2.5-x86_64

 

4.创建用户组和用户

groupadd mysql

useradd -r -g mysql mysql

 

5.修改权限

chown -R mysql:mysql ./

 

6.安装数据库

./script/mysql_install_db —user=mysql

 

7.修改当前目录拥有者

chown -R root:root ./

chowd -R mysql:mysql data

 

8.添加mysql为系统服务

cp support-files/mysql.server /etc/init.d/mysql

 

9.修改mysql服务路径配置

vi /etc/init.d/mysql  

修改 basedir=mysql安装包路径、datadir=mysql数据存放目录(默认为mysql安装包路径/data)

 

10.复制配置mysql配置文件

先查看support-files目录下是否有mysql-medium.cnf文件,有的话直接复制就好了cp support-files/mysql-medium.cnf my.cnf 

如果没有就自己配置下

 

11.添加mysql系统变量

vi /etc/profile       //编辑该文件

修改PATH=$PATH:MYSQL安装包路径/bin   //按字母i进入编辑模式 esc退出编辑模式  :x保存并退出

source /etc/profile   //使文件生效

echo $PATH    // 查看是否加入成功

 

12.启动mysql

service mysql start  

 

13.命令行连接MYSQL

mysql -u root -p  //新安装默认没有密码,输入后直接回车即可

 

14.sql基本语句

SHOW DATABASES;  //查看当前所有数据库

CREATE DATABASE 数据库名;  //创建数据库

USE  数据库名; //选择数据库

SOURCE SQL文件路径; //导入数据

GRANT ALL PRIVILEGES ON 数据库名.* TO 用户名@"%" IDENTIFIED BY '密码' WITH GRANT OPTION; //创建一个远程用户使他有某个数据库的所有权限

© 著作权归作者所有

共有 人打赏支持
m
粉丝 1
博文 75
码字总数 53353
作品 0
东莞
程序员
分布式架构3--CentOs下安装MySQL(环境准备)

声明:因为运行环境是基于Linux系统的,在做此框架之前需要做一些前期的环境准备工作 CentOs下安装MySQL网上很多实例,因为博客后期作为框架的原生教程,故这边做详细的安装记录,我这边已经...

明理萝
07/19
0
0
linux 环境下安装mysql----ubuntu

可能对初学者帮助比较大,用熟的大神门估计步骤都是记得的。 列下具体的安装步骤: `步骤: 1、cd到某个路径下执行下面指令: wget http://dev.mysql.com/get/Downloads/MySQL-5.6/mysql-5....

niedongri
07/26
0
0
大数据社区整理的Linux运维笔试面试题(47题)

大数据社区整理的Linux运维笔试面试题(47题) Linux操作系统知识 1. Linux开机启动流程详细步骤是什么?忘记密码如何破解? 2. 企业中Linux数据库服务器做raid几,你们原来公司的数据库服务...

代金券优惠
06/06
0
0
MySQL安装与应用【Linux下的安装与配置】

Linux下的安装与配置 如果所安装的Linux系统没有内置的MySQL,笔者建议在Linux中使用RPM包来安装MySQL,同样这也是MySQL官方提供的建议。笔者接触最多的Linux系统是Radhat的“近亲”:CentO...

晨曦之光
2012/03/09
0
0
ubuntu下安装Apache+PHP+Mysql....So简单

电影《社交网络》中,facebook创始人马克.扎克失恋后入侵哈佛大学宿舍楼服务器,窃取数据库资料,并在两个小时内完成了一个给校内女生评分的交互网站,该网站一天内点击数过10W,直接导致学校...

Kobe_Gong_5
2012/11/15
0
0

没有更多内容

加载失败,请刷新页面

加载更多

ionic安卓打包过程

在项目文件夹下执行命令 ionic cordova platform add android 打开android studio -> Configure->SDK Manager

lilugirl
2分钟前
0
0
arts-week14

Algorithm 923. 3Sum With Multiplicity - LeetCode Review Building a network attached storage device with a Raspberry Pi 搭建家用储存系统,使用树莓派和移动硬盘,搭建一个 NAS,操作......

yysue
4分钟前
0
0
理解OAuth 2.0

OAuth是一个关于授权(authorization)的开放网络标准,在全世界得到广泛应用,目前的版本是2.0版。 本文对OAuth 2.0的设计思路和运行流程,做一个简明通俗的解释,主要参考材料为RFC 6749。...

吴伟祥
16分钟前
0
0
源码中常用英文单词

Resolver BeansDtdResolver : spring bean dtd 解析器

职业搬砖工程师
18分钟前
0
0
区块链入门教程以太坊源码分析event源码分析

兄弟连区块链入门教程以太坊源码分析event源码分析,2018年下半年,区块链行业正逐渐褪去发展之初的浮躁、回归理性,表面上看相关人才需求与身价似乎正在回落。但事实上,正是初期泡沫的渐退...

兄弟连区块链入门教程
19分钟前
0
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部